Under general supervision, leads supply chain personnel in planning activities, determines scheduling policy for all product lines, produces and maintains a viable master production schedule based on forecast and firm sales orders and ensures production schedule compliance. Provides accurate product delivery dates to Customer Service and communicates requirements throughout the organization via SIOP and Master Scheduling processes. Directs activities and efforts required for optimum utilization of material and provides direction for prioritization of these materials required to support production plans.

  • Supports SIOP processes and leads the development of the Master Production Schedule (MPS). Develops and adheres to scheduling policies for products to satisfy forecasted requirements and level load plant operations.
  • Performs as master scheduler in the SIOP Planning (sales, inventory, and operations planning) process for the facility
  • Formulates, produces, publishes, and maintains 12-month rolling forecast and 3-month master production schedule, utilizing current marketing whole goods forecasts, knowledge of shop floor capacity, component availability, and product knowledge.
  • Oversees and guides weekly production and scheduling meetings providing status of current production runs, purchase shortages and capacity problems/solutions.
  • Develop and implement inventory management systems to optimize storage, reduce waste and ensure accurate stock levels through regular cycle counts.
  • Manage the kitting process to ensure all required components are organized and delivered to align with production schedules.
  • Manage warehouse operations ensuring that materials are received, stored, and dispatched efficiently.
  • Develop and implement warehouse policies and procedures to improve operational efficiency. This includes optimizing layout and workflow to maximize space utilization.
  • Provides completion dates for in-process and new sales orders to Customer Service. Communicates with Production Supervisors, Purchasing, Sales, and Customer Service to ensure production delivery dates are accurate and consistent with production schedules.
  • Monitors production schedule status and measures schedule reliability and adherence.
  • Maintains JD Edwards planning and scheduling data, including the Shop Calendar and Work Center Master Data to align with planned production parameters (headcount, shifts, and hours).
  • Assists in development of annual manpower planning models to identify labor constraints and overtime requirements. Creates and provides Capacity Planning Reports to production.
  • May manage/lead one or more Production Planners in daily planning and scheduling activities.
